While \u003ca href=\"\/en\/products\/tuga-chemie-alu-teufel-spezial-gruen-felgenreiniger\"\u003eAlu-Teufel Spezial Grün\u003c\/a\u003e was primarily developed for car rims, Biker's Felgen-Teufel addresses the specific material challenges of motorcycle rims: anodized aluminum rim flanges, steel spokes with localized stress, carbon rim components on sport bikes, and sensitive clear coat seals with high UV exposure due to open design.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eTUGA Chemie from Osnabrück has been producing these formulations in Germany for decades, supplying commercial detailers, workshops, and ambitious private customers in the DACH region.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eThe chemical architecture is related to the green Alu-Teufel: the cleaner works in a precisely balanced pH range of 6.5 to 7.5 — pH-neutral, neither acidic nor alkaline. This neutrality is the cornerstone of material protection, because neither anodized layers nor sensitive carbon clear coats are chemically attacked.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eThe actual active ingredient is sodium thioglycolate — a reducing agent that specifically targets inorganic iron(III) compounds, such as those formed by the abrasion of brake discs and pads. When the gel comes into contact with brake dust, the thioglycolate initiates chelation: the molecules enclose the iron ion like a crab's pincers (hence \"chelate,\" Greek for crab's claw), reducing water-insoluble iron(III) to water-soluble iron(II) and binding it in a red-violet complex. The color change from light green to violet to reddish-brown serves as a visual indicator of its effectiveness.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eThe thixotropic gel consistency (due to non-ionic and amphoteric surfactants plus xanthan thickener) prevents the product from immediately running off vertical rim beds due to gravity. It adheres in place, organically encapsulates road grime, and allows the sodium thioglycolate to work undisturbed on the inorganic brake dust — crucial for motorcycle rims, whose complex spoke geometry offers a large adhesion surface.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cul\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eCarbon rim compatible — the decisive USP for sport bikes.\u003c\/strong\u003e Unlike acidic wheel cleaners that can chemically reactivate carbon fiber ends on damaged clear coat, the pH-neutral Biker's Felgen-Teufel can also be safely used on carbon rims with intact clear coat. The TUGA price is 35 to 45 percent below premium brands with comparable chemical effectiveness — a relevant cost difference for weekly bike washing during the touring season.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cimg src=\"https:\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0800\/3272\/7375\/files\/d1_tuga-chemie-bikers-felgen-teufel-felgenreiniger-motorrad_hero_d4e28f28-cbf8-4838-b6df-3c468e9510c1.png?v=1777969722\" alt=\"Biker's Felgen-Teufel Hero\" loading=\"lazy\" style=\"width:100%;height:auto;border-radius:4px;\"\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003chr\u003e\n\n\u003cblockquote class=\"praxistipp\"\u003e\n  \u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003ePractical tip from Detailing1:\u003c\/strong\u003e In our workshop, we see the most frequent loss of efficiency with Bikers Felgen-Teufel by spraying it onto wet rims directly after pre-washing. The amount of water on the rim surface immediately dilutes the cleaner gel — the concentration drops below the effective range, and consumption increases by 50 percent without a corresponding improvement in cleaning. The correct method: roughly pre-rinse the rim with high pressure, then surface dry with compressed air or a dry microfiber cloth, and only then spray on the gel. The second classic mistake with motorcycles with an exposed brake system behind the wheel (typical for enduros and naked bikes): spraying the gel directly into the brake caliper. The surfactants dissolve lubricants from the brake cylinder seals, visible only weeks later as a loss of brake pressure. For sport bikes with carbon-ceramic brakes, allow 45 minutes for cooling, otherwise the gel will evaporate on the 200-degree hot calipers in seconds instead of the expected minutes.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/blockquote\u003e\n\n\u003chr\u003e\n\n\u003ch3\u003ePre-rinsed dry rim, spray from bottom up, 3 to 5 minutes exposure time, rinse with high pressure.\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eThe standard workflow begins with checking the rim temperature. For sport bikes with high braking loads and carbon-ceramic brakes, wait at least 30 to 45 minutes after the ride; for touring bikes with conventional brake systems, 15 to 20 minutes. If exposed to direct sunlight, move the bike into the shade — black sport rims can heat up to 50 degrees in 10 minutes in summer sun.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eRoughly pre-rinse the rim with a high-pressure water jet — this removes loose road dirt, insect remains on the outside of the rims, and chain dust. Then surface dry with compressed air or a dry microfiber cloth. This step is important: a wet rim bed immediately dilutes the cleaning gel and reduces the concentration below the effective range.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eSpray Biker's Felgen-Teufel evenly from 20 to 30 centimeters away, from bottom to top. The direction is critical: working from top to bottom creates concentration gradients and drip marks. For steel-spoke rims, apply the gel specifically at the spoke roots and at the spoke-rim transition — this is where the most stubborn brake dust collects.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eAllow to work for three to five minutes. The color change indicator (light green → violet → reddish-brown) visually shows where the brake dust is dissolved and when the reaction is complete. For heavily encrusted areas, agitate with a soft detailing brush or specialized \u003ca href=\"\/en\/collections\/felgenpflege\"\u003emotorcycle wheel brush\u003c\/a\u003e during the exposure time — use circular motions, no pressure, the gel spreads more evenly.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eThen rinse thoroughly with a sharp high-pressure water jet, leaving no residue. First from bottom to top (loosens the lower rim edge), then with clear water from top to bottom (flushes all residues safely into the lower area). Also thoroughly rinse the back of the rim and the areas between spokes and rim flange — dissolved iron complex collects there and can cause rust transfer if it dries.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cimg src=\"https:\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0800\/3272\/7375\/files\/d1_tuga-chemie-bikers-felgen-teufel-felgenreiniger-motorrad_anwendung_37182a80-bc34-4b1e-87d1-dccaa9cbdf32.png?v=1777969729\" alt=\"Biker's Felgen-Teufel Anwendung\" loading=\"lazy\" style=\"width:100%;height:auto;border-radius:4px;\"\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ch3\u003eCarbon, paint, chrome and steel spokes yes. High-gloss polished aluminum and black chromated no.\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eBiker's Felgen-Teufel is approved for a wide range of materials typically found on motorcycle rims. Carbon rims with intact clear coat (BST, Marchesini, Rotobox), painted aluminum rims, clear-coated steel-spoke rims, chrome rim edges, multi-piece sport rims with aluminum spokes and carbon shells, powder-coated steel rims.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eTwo material groups are strictly excluded. First, unpainted, high-gloss polished aluminum (often on custom sport bikes or classic cruisers): Even if the pH value is neutral, sodium thioglycolate can cause dull oxidation upon direct contact with bare aluminum surfaces. Cover polished aluminum rim edges or un-clear-coated rim flange interiors with tape before application.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eSecond, black chromated components (often on premium sport bikes like Ducati Panigale V4 or BMW S1000RR). The thin chromate layer is susceptible to any reducing chemistry — even pH-neutral thioglycolate can cause dull spots after prolonged exposure. Keep a safe distance from these rims or brake caliper components.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eFor classic spoked rims with galvanized spokes (typical for BMW R-Boxer models, older touring bikes), application is compatible as long as the galvanization is intact. If the galvanization is damaged or steel areas are exposed, repair the spokes beforehand — otherwise, the cleaner can accelerate corrosion at the break points.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eIn the off-label area, Biker's Felgen-Teufel is increasingly used for e-bike rims — pedelecs with complex wired mid-motors have similar rim materials to motorcycles, plus the high loads from disc brakes generate a lot of brake dust. Important: The cleaner has no degreasing properties for bearing grease — those cleaning cassettes must work with dedicated degreasers beforehand.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eSafety note: The product falls under GHS07 with hazard statements H302 (harmful if swallowed) and H319 (causes serious eye irritation). Nitrile gloves and safety glasses are mandatory during application. In case of skin contact, rinse thoroughly with water immediately — thioglycolate compounds can cause allergies with frequent exposure. Proper disposal follows AVV waste codes for iron complex solutions — never into household waste or normal sewers. When using on carbon rims with clear coat defects, mandatory clear coat repair before cleaning — otherwise, fiber fraying.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003chr\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eMatching products:\u003c\/strong\u003e \u003ca href=\"\/en\/collections\/felgenreiniger\"\u003eWheel Cleaner Overview\u003c\/a\u003e • \u003ca href=\"\/en\/products\/tuga-chemie-bikers-super-teufel-motorradreiniger\"\u003eBiker's Super-Teufel (All-Purpose Cleaner)\u003c\/a\u003e • \u003ca href=\"\/en\/products\/tuga-chemie-felgenbuerste-alu-teufel-spezial-gruen\"\u003eTUGA Wheel Brush\u003c\/a\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cimg src=\"https:\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0800\/3272\/7375\/files\/d1_tuga-chemie-bikers-felgen-teufel-felgenreiniger-motorrad_lineup_2bb2f358-115a-412a-8e19-d5766b3cc5db.png?v=1777969741\" alt=\"Biker's Felgen-Teufel Lineup\" loading=\"lazy\" style=\"width:100%;height:auto;border-radius:4px;\"\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"TUGA Chemie","offers":[{"title":"1000 ml \/ 1 liter","offer_id":57272484790607,"sku":"D1-TUG-BF1D","price":20.23,"currency_code":"EUR","in_stock":true},{"title":"5 liters","offer_id":57272484823375,"sku":"D1-TUG-BF5D","price":70.16,"currency_code":"EUR","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0800\/3272\/7375\/files\/tuga-chemie-bikers-felgen-teufel-felgenreiniger-motorrad_1000ml.png?v=1774283344","url":"https:\/\/detailing1.be\/en\/products\/tuga-chemie-bikers-felgen-teufel-felgenreiniger-motorrad","provider":"Detailing1","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
